Transaction dfc584435395bf8fc630a7725e9c3b9ebf89c9079392f1860752c893369f36a7
1 Input
1 Output
-
dfc584435395bf8fc630a7725e9c3b9ebf89c9079392f1860752c893369f36a7:0
- value
- 35263482
- script pubkey
- OP_0 OP_PUSHBYTES_20 8427154dda1467355055cfcba9bea85285d8cbd0
- address
- bc1qssn32nw6z3nn25z4el96n04g22za3j7sky6pk2